      By Neil Maidment LONDON (Reuters) – Britain embarked on its largest privatisation in decades on Thursday as the government unveiled plans to sell the majority of the near 500-year-old state-owned Royal Mail postal service. The Department for Business said a stock market flotation would take place in coming weeks, giving the public a chance to…
